Last Thursday, United Continental Holdings announced the first new routes after the merger, including additions from all three mainland hubs of Continental and from all domestic hubs of United except Chicago O'Hare.
One notable addition is United's first service to Dallas Love Field since the opening of DFW. Twice-daily service to Love Field from Denver will be flown by ExpressJet Airlines, operating as United Express, using Embraer 145 aircraft with 50 seats, avoiding the Wright Amendment limits which were the subject of the Featured Map on 13 October 2010. Continental already serves Love Field with flights from Houston.
